As with everything in life, everyone is entitled to an opinion.
In reference to the so called "protected species" it is perception more than anything.
Assuming it is the poster I believe that you are referencing, they have received a few one day bans in the past few months.
Most of that poster's posts are not reported and therefore not read or assessed. So I cannot comment on them.
The posts that are reported fall into the following categories
- not valid as a breach
- not severe enough for a one day ban
- severe enough for a one day ban (and they were issued)
- not severe enough for a one week ban
Now they are just better than others of posting without breaching the rules even if they are at the edge of the rules and therefore don't get banned as often as others - or for as long as others.
As for the exodus from Saintsational - the major exodus was before my time.
Posters left because they were being abused / threatened / ridiculed and every thread was a constant stream of bickering.
The posters that have gone from here (full permanent ban) were those that were serial offenders at ruining the community and were not here to talk football.
The place (when football was on this year) was a much better environment to talk football.
I understand that now there is no football, that this is an interesting time for reflection.
As I have stated previously - I am absolutely fine for there to be a few hundred posters here posting about footy, rather than thousands abusing, threatening and bickering constantly. For now, most of the real trouble makers are gone.
And if someone is posting something that is a breach of the rules in your eyes - REPORT THEM - because that's the only way it will be reviewed and assessed.
